Celebrity Profile:
Benjamin Butler

Artist


Ben spent last year in New Year designing sets for music videos featuring such stars as TLC, Big Pun, Save Ferris, and Moby. He is currently a senior at Bowdoin College in Maine re-manipulating 120,000+ lbs of railroad ties weekly around his campus.
